Rodgers expects "tough game" at West Brom

Swansea City boss Brendan Rodgers has said that he expects a tough test when his side travel to the Hawthorns this weekend.

Rodgers, who led his side to a 3-0 win over the Baggies in the reverse fixture, admits that the club must remain as thorough in their preparations as usual and not allow themselves to become complacent.

"It will be a very tough game on Saturday," he said. "Roy's teams are always hard to beat and they will be well organised.

"Our motivation and preparation is always thorough. We will have to be patient, but we are looking forward and it's another chance for us to pick up some more points."

Swansea are currently one point ahead of Roy Hodgson's side in the Premier League.
